5 Essential Tips for Planning a Move

You end up with more “stuff” than you anticipated, you didn’t account for fragile items and your hired help slaps you with hidden moving feeds. Moving can be stressful and so if you want to ensure smooth sailing on the day of, you want to be as prepared as possible

If you’re planning a move, here are five essential tips you need to know before planning your move.

1. Make a Master List

If you want some beneficial moving advice, making a list is at the top of the list.

Sit down and write down a list of everything you need to do. From last-minute details of selling a home down to moving day details, write everything down. You can make this an ongoing list so keep it where you can see it and add to it often.

Do a walkthrough of your house with the list-in-hand, and write down all of the tasks that come to mind – no detail too small.

2. Purge Before You Pack

Many of us don’t actually realize how much stuff we have until it’s time to move it all. In fact, there are up to 15 million hoarders in America, most of whom don’t know that their abundance of “stuff” is problematic.

This is by far one of the best moving tips and it should be second on the list. In fact, getting rid of junk in your home can help you save a few steps in your checklist.

You can donate things to charity, or have a yard sale to get rid of unnecessary items.

You could also consider doing this before selling your home. Buyers are more likely to buy your house for cash if it’s well-organized and free of clutter.

3. Get Multiple Quotes

Before you move, you will want to get multiple quotes from multiple movers. Don’t go for the cheapest option because as they say, you get what you pay for. Find a reliable mover, perhaps a company recommended by friends or coworkers.

If you’re moving to another state, the prices will vary and likely be a little higher. You can decide if you want to rent a truck and drive it yourself across State lines, or if it’s more cost-effective to have movers do this for you.

4. Gather Free Moving Supplies

Paying for moving supplies is an additional cost that is totally avoidable. You will not need the boxes after you’ve moved, so try to collect them a few weeks before your move.

Lots of grocery stores have a stock of boxes that are free for the taking. You can also talk to friends and coworkers to raid their garages for any boxes they may have.

5. Get Help From Friends and Family

Don’t be afraid to reach out to friends and family for help. That’s what they are there for. A few extra sets of hands can make the move go by much quicker and most efficient.

It is also nice to have the support of friends and family on such an important day.

Get in the Groove When Planning a Move

Moving can be stressful but with the proper preparation, it doesn’t have to be. When planning a move, be sure to make a solid list, purge your home, get free supplies, and get help from your loved ones.
